社区
搬砖的乔布梭的课程社区_NO_1
Python并发管理
帖子详情
进程池同步与异步
搬砖的乔布梭
领域专家: 后端开发技术领域
2023-01-12 23:51:27
课时名称
课时知识点
进程池同步与异步
...全文
89
回复
打赏
收藏
进程池同步与异步
课时名称课时知识点进程池同步与异步
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
Python:
进程
池
,
同步
和
异步
,
进程
池
通信示例
enumerate() 不管任务是否完成,立即终止,如果使用
异步
提交任务,等
进程
池
内任务都处理完,需要用get()来收集结果。Manager()模块专门用来做数据共享,支持很多类型,如value,array,list,dict,Queue,Lock等。print(f'rd启动{os.getpid()},父
进程
{os.getppid()}')print(f'wd启动{os.getpid()},父
进程
{os.getppid()}')p.close() 关闭
进程
池
,防止进一步操作(
进程
池
不接受新的任务)
进程
池
的
同步
与
异步
用法Pool
进程
池
的
同步
,如下程序: from multiprocessing import Pool import time import os def func(n): print('start
进程
%s'%n, os.getpid()) time.sleep...
进程
池
与线程
池
的简单介绍
一.什么是
池
池
的功能是限制启动的
进程
数或线程数 那么什么时候应该限制? 当并发的任务数远远超过了计算机的承受能力时,即无法一次性开启过多的
进程
数或线程数时,就应该用
池
的概念将开启的
进程
数或线程数限制在计算机可承受的范围内 二.
同步
与
异步
同步
:提交任务后就在原地等待,直到任务运行完毕后拿到任务的返回值,再继续运行下一行代码,会导致任务是串行执行的
异步
:提交任务(绑定一个回调函...
进程
同步
/
异步
的区别
https://www.2cto.com/kf/201810/782078.html
进程
同步
:这是
进程
间的一种运行关系。“同”是协同,按照一定的顺序协同进行(有序进行),而不是同时。即一组
进程
为了协调其推进速度,在某些地方需要相互等待或者唤醒,这种
进程
间的相互制约就被称作是
进程
同步
。这种合作现象在操作系统和并发式编程中属于经常性事件。具有
同步
关系的一组并发
进程
称为合作
进程
间接制约:当两个进...
Python 并发编程全面指南(多线程 多
进程
进程
池
线程
池
协程和
异步
编程) 队列
Python 并发编程指南:全面解析多线程、多
进程
与
异步
编程 本文系统介绍了 Python 中的并发编程技术,包括多线程、多
进程
、
进程
池
、线程
池
以及协程与
异步
编程的区别。多线程适合 I/O 密集型任务但受 GIL 限制,多
进程
适合 CPU 密集型任务但开销较大。
进程
池
和线程
池
提供了更高级的抽象,简化了并发管理。协程和
异步
编程则通过非阻塞方式高效处理 I/O 操作。文章通过代码示例详细演示了各种技术的实现方式,包括线程
同步
、
进程
间通信以及
池
化技术,帮助开发者根据任务类型选择最合适的并发方案。
搬砖的乔布梭的课程社区_NO_1
1
社区成员
482
社区内容
发帖
与我相关
我的任务
搬砖的乔布梭的课程社区_NO_1
复制链接
扫一扫
分享
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章